    📅 Start With the Age of Your AC System

    Equipment age is one of the first factors to consider. Air conditioners do not have a universal expiration date, but performance and reliability often decline as components wear.

    A well-maintained system may remain useful for many years, while equipment exposed to poor airflow, dirty coils, improper installation, or limited maintenance may develop serious problems sooner.

    If your system is relatively new and has otherwise performed reliably, a repair may be the practical choice. If it is approaching the later portion of its expected service life, replacement deserves stronger consideration—especially when the repair is expensive.

    Age should never be the only deciding factor. A professional technician should evaluate the system’s actual condition before recommending AC replacement.

    💰 Compare the Repair Cost With Replacement Value

    A lower repair price does not always mean repairing is the better financial decision. Consider how much useful service the repair is likely to provide.

    For example, replacing a modestly priced electrical component on a reliable system may be worthwhile. Spending a substantial amount on a major component in an aging system with other signs of wear may provide less long-term value.

    Ask these questions before approving a repair:

    • How much will the repair cost?
    • Is the failed component covered by a warranty?
    • What caused the failure?
    • Are other major components showing wear?
    • How long is the repair expected to last?
    • Has the system needed other repairs recently?
    • How efficient is the existing equipment?
    • What would a replacement system cost?
    • Are there suitable financing options?

    A repair estimate should be considered in the context of the system’s complete condition, not as an isolated expense.

    🔄 Consider How Often the AC Needs Repairs

    An occasional repair does not necessarily mean that an air conditioner should be replaced. Capacitors, contactors, fan motors, and other components can fail even when the rest of the system remains serviceable.

    Frequent repairs are more concerning. If you have called for service several times within a short period, the accumulated costs and repeated disruptions may indicate that the system is becoming unreliable.

    Review service records if they are available. Look for patterns such as recurring refrigerant leaks, electrical problems, motor failures, drainage issues, or repeated breakdowns during hot weather.

    A system that requires constant attention can be expensive even when each individual repair seems manageable.

    ⚡ Rising Energy Bills May Indicate Declining Efficiency

    Older or poorly performing air conditioners may consume more electricity while delivering less cooling.

    Compare energy use from similar months and weather conditions. A summer bill will naturally be higher than a spring bill, but a significant year-over-year increase may indicate reduced efficiency.

    Possible causes include:

    • Dirty evaporator or condenser coils
    • Restricted airflow
    • Leaking ductwork
    • Low refrigerant
    • A worn blower motor
    • Compressor problems
    • Incorrect thermostat operation
    • Aging equipment

    Some efficiency problems can be corrected through maintenance or repair. However, if the equipment is old and requires extensive work, a modern high-efficiency system may provide better long-term value.

    Potential energy savings vary according to the existing system, replacement equipment, thermostat habits, home insulation, duct condition, climate, and utility rates. Avoid assuming that a new system will reduce every energy bill by a specific amount without a detailed evaluation.

    🌡️ Think About Your Current Comfort

    An air conditioner can technically operate while still failing to provide acceptable comfort.

    Ask whether the existing system:

    • Maintains the thermostat setting
    • Cools rooms evenly
    • Controls indoor humidity
    • Produces sufficient airflow
    • Operates quietly
    • Completes normal cooling cycles
    • Keeps up during hot afternoons

    Persistent hot and cold spots may involve ductwork, insulation, airflow, or equipment sizing rather than the air conditioner alone. Replacing the outdoor unit will not necessarily solve a distribution problem.

    Before recommending new equipment, a qualified HVAC professional should consider whether repairs or home improvements could restore comfort.

    ⏱️ Long Cooling Cycles Can Signal Trouble

    Air conditioners naturally run longer during periods of intense heat. However, a system that operates almost constantly under ordinary conditions may be losing capacity or efficiency.

    Extended operation can result from dirty coils, refrigerant issues, clogged filters, duct leakage, undersized equipment, poor insulation, or worn components.

    If the system is relatively young, correcting the underlying problem may restore normal performance. If it is older and several major issues are present, replacement may be more cost-effective.

    Lowering the thermostat dramatically will not make a typical central air conditioner cool faster. It only tells the equipment to continue running toward a lower target.

    🔁 Frequent Starting and Stopping Should Be Diagnosed

    Short cycling occurs when an air conditioner starts, operates briefly, shuts down, and restarts again soon afterward.

    Possible causes include:

    • A thermostat problem
    • Restricted airflow
    • A frozen evaporator coil
    • Electrical issues
    • Low refrigerant
    • Oversized equipment
    • Compressor trouble

    Frequent cycling can waste energy and increase wear on critical components. It should be diagnosed before deciding whether to repair or replace the system.

    If oversized equipment is responsible, replacing individual components will not correct the original sizing problem. A properly performed load calculation may be needed when selecting new equipment.

    🧊 Refrigerant Type and Leak Location Matter

    A refrigerant leak does not automatically require full AC replacement. The appropriate solution depends on the system’s age, refrigerant type, leak location, repair cost, and availability of compatible parts.

    A small leak at an accessible connection may be repairable. A leak in a badly deteriorated evaporator coil or another costly component may make replacement more attractive, especially on an aging system.

    Refrigerant is not normally consumed during AC operation. If the system is low, a leak or incorrect charge should be investigated. Simply adding refrigerant without addressing the source is not a dependable long-term solution.

    ⚙️ A Compressor Failure Requires Careful Evaluation

    The compressor is a major and often costly part of an air-conditioning system. Its failure can make replacement worth considering, but the compressor should be properly diagnosed first.

    A failed capacitor, contactor, wiring problem, incorrect refrigerant charge, or control issue can sometimes produce symptoms that appear similar to compressor trouble.

    If the compressor has failed, consider:

    • Equipment age
    • Warranty coverage
    • Labor costs
    • Refrigerant type
    • Condition of the indoor and outdoor coils
    • Repair history
    • Efficiency of the existing system
    • Compatibility of replacement components

    Replacing a compressor in a newer system under warranty may make sense. Paying for a major compressor repair on an old, inefficient system may be less appealing.

    🛡️ Review Your Warranty Coverage

    Warranty coverage can significantly affect the repair-or-replace decision.

    HVAC equipment may include a manufacturer’s parts warranty, while labor coverage may be separate. Warranty terms vary by brand, registration status, installation date, component, and original ownership.

    Before approving an expensive repair, determine:

    • Whether the part is covered
    • Whether the warranty was registered
    • Whether labor is included
    • Whether maintenance records are required
    • Whether the warranty transfers to a new homeowner
    • What exclusions apply

    Even when a component is covered, you may still be responsible for labor, refrigerant, diagnostic fees, shipping, or other expenses.

    🏷️ Consider the Availability of Replacement Parts

    As HVAC equipment ages, certain parts may become harder or more expensive to obtain. A discontinued proprietary control board, motor, coil, or communicating component can complicate repairs.

    Availability does not always mean that repair is impossible, but extended delays may be difficult during hot weather. The replacement part must also be compatible with the existing equipment.

    If a critical component is unavailable or requires an unusually long wait, replacing the system may restore comfort more quickly and provide improved parts availability.

    🌿 New Equipment May Offer Better Efficiency

    Modern air conditioners may offer higher energy efficiency than older systems, particularly when replacing equipment that has significantly declined in performance.

    Efficiency ratings are important, but the highest-rated system is not automatically the best choice for every home. Proper sizing, ductwork, installation quality, thermostat compatibility, and maintenance all affect real-world performance.

    A moderately efficient system installed correctly may perform better than premium equipment connected to undersized, leaking, or poorly designed ducts.

    When comparing replacement options, ask about:

    • Cooling efficiency
    • Variable-speed or multi-stage operation
    • Sound levels
    • Humidity control
    • Thermostat compatibility
    • Warranty terms
    • Installation requirements
    • Maintenance needs
    • Total installed cost

    Choose equipment based on the home and household—not only on the number printed on the product label.

    📐 Proper AC Sizing Is Essential

    Replacing an old system with equipment of the same capacity may seem reasonable, but the original unit could have been improperly sized. The home may also have changed through remodeling, window replacement, insulation improvements, or room additions.

    A professional cooling-load calculation considers factors such as:

    • Home size and layout
    • Insulation levels
    • Window area and orientation
    • Air leakage
    • Ceiling height
    • Sun exposure
    • Occupancy
    • Local climate
    • Heat-producing appliances

    An oversized air conditioner may cool the house too quickly and shut off before removing enough humidity. An undersized system may run continuously and still fail to maintain comfort.

    Correct sizing supports efficiency, comfort, moisture control, and equipment longevity.

    💨 Inspect the Ductwork Before Replacing Equipment

    A new air conditioner cannot deliver its full benefit through damaged or poorly designed ducts.

    Duct problems may include:

    • Air leaks
    • Disconnected sections
    • Crushed flexible ducts
    • Inadequate insulation
    • Poorly sized branches
    • Missing return-air pathways
    • Excessive static pressure
    • Unbalanced airflow

    If the existing system has always produced uneven temperatures or weak airflow, request a duct evaluation before installation.

    Repairing or modifying the distribution system may improve comfort and help protect the new equipment from airflow-related problems.

    📱 Think About Thermostat Compatibility

    Replacement HVAC equipment may support features that an older thermostat cannot control. Multi-stage, variable-speed, heat-pump, zoned, and communicating systems can require specific thermostat capabilities.

    A compatible smart thermostat may provide:

    • Customized schedules
    • Remote access
    • Energy reports
    • Humidity information
    • Maintenance reminders
    • Room sensor support
    • Equipment alerts

    The thermostat should be selected as part of the overall system rather than treated as an afterthought.

    Professional configuration is especially important when the equipment uses multiple stages or specialized controls.

    🛠️ When AC Repair Is Usually Worth Considering

    Repair may be the practical choice when:

    • The system is relatively new
    • It has been reliable overall
    • The repair is affordable
    • The failed part is covered by warranty
    • The system still cools the home evenly
    • Energy bills remain reasonable
    • No major additional problems are present
    • Replacement parts are readily available

    A professional repair can restore operation and help you receive more useful service from equipment that remains in good general condition.

    🆕 When AC Replacement May Be the Better Choice

    Replacement deserves stronger consideration when:

    • The equipment is approaching the end of its useful life
    • Repair costs are substantial
    • Breakdowns occur frequently
    • Energy consumption keeps increasing
    • The system cannot maintain comfort
    • Major components are deteriorating
    • Refrigerant or parts are difficult to obtain
    • The equipment is improperly sized
    • You plan to remain in the home
    • You want improved efficiency or humidity control

    Replacement should solve a defined problem. Ask the contractor to explain how the proposed system addresses your comfort, reliability, or efficiency concerns.

    🧮 Look Beyond the Immediate Price

    The lowest immediate cost and the best long-term value are not always the same.

    When comparing repair and replacement, consider:

    • Today’s repair expense
    • Likelihood of additional repairs
    • Remaining system life
    • Monthly operating costs
    • Warranty protection
    • Financing costs
    • Comfort improvements
    • Reliability during hot weather
    • Plans for the property

    If you expect to move soon, your priorities may differ from those of someone planning to remain in the home for many years. There is no universal answer, so the decision should reflect both equipment condition and household goals.

    🚫 Avoid Making the Decision Under Pressure

    A summer breakdown can make any homeowner feel rushed. If possible, request a clear diagnosis and written options before approving major work.

    Ask the technician to identify:

    • The failed component
    • The cause of failure
    • The cost of repair
    • The condition of the remaining system
    • Available warranty coverage
    • The urgency of the work
    • Replacement alternatives

    Be cautious of recommendations based solely on equipment age or a generic pricing formula. Those tools can be useful starting points, but they do not replace a complete system evaluation.
